    Selma, Alabama boasts one of the strangest missing person's cases in the south. Orion Williamson vanished without a trace, in full view of 6 witnesses. Let's explore the possibilities of what could have happened.

I've come across both this story (which is widely circulated still) and the Tianog tale elsewhere - it is interesting to see how you link them together and bring in the fairy rings legends too. Must admit, I'm a sceptic - somewhere on Wikipedia there's a thorough debunking of the story, stating that Orion never existed, and that Ambrose Bierce made the story up. Now that is quite possible, given the fact that US papers of that era often made up 'johnny warbies' or 'baba misteg' purely for the amusement of their readers - but, like the Loch Ness Monster, its more fun just to take the story with a shovelful of sodium chloride, suspend belief and unbelief and enjoy it!
